
Enforced Collection Techniques
Enforced collection techniques refer to methods used by creditors to recover debts that have not been paid voluntarily. These techniques can include legal actions like filing lawsuits, obtaining court judgments, and garnishing wages or bank accounts. Creditors might also use collection agencies to retrieve outstanding debts. The goal is to compel debtors to fulfill their financial obligations, often resulting in increased pressure to pay. While these methods are legal and part of the debt recovery process, they can cause significant stress for individuals facing financial difficulties.
